Things That You Should Consider in Billing and Coding Programs

There are specific things you must consider whenever you’re ready to pick between Medical coding schools. Picking billing and coding programs might possibly appear easy, yet you have to make sure that you are picking the best style of training. Prior to signing a contract with the Certified Billing and Coding Specialist training program you have chosen, it is heavily recommended that you check out the accreditation status of the training course with the Michigan State Board. Several other things that you’ll have to take note of aside from accreditation include:

  • Talk with the state-level board of Medical Insurance Coding Specialist to find out where the school rates against its competitors
  • Percentage of attendees successfully completing the certification examination
  • How exactly does the price of the course look when placed against similar training programs?

A number of Qualifications Offered Throughout Medical Coding and Billing

(RHIA) Exam

The Registered Health Info Administrator exam examination is known as a accreditation for your skill to manage patient health related data and individual health information and data. The RHIA certification can easily open up some other employment opportunities a result of the scope of work and necessity of the position.

CMRS Evaluation

The CMRS evaluation or Licensed Medical Reimbursement Specialist examination, The American Medical Billers Association (AMBA) features this valuable official certification to get an improved qualification portfolio for the purpose of job development.
